Transaction cb34f2a59cad40a489dcfa58b30c738cc12b07997f21833b07498304c88a3c91
1 Input
2 Outputs
- cb34f2a59cad40a489dcfa58b30c738cc12b07997f21833b07498304c88a3c91:0
- cb34f2a59cad40a489dcfa58b30c738cc12b07997f21833b07498304c88a3c91:1
value 37150911
address 1FX3mrnBXSksaKayS4vs1RCAvSeFiGQWT9
value 20100000
address 18sjp3iu6hQA8TKhFtxqC26RvXxc5XpWwz